The Syracuse Orange men’s basketball team (5-4) will try to make three straight wins when they host the Georgetown Hoyas (5-5) on Saturday afternoon at the JMA Wireless Dome.
The two squads will meet for the 98th time, with Syracuse holding a slight 52-45 advantage in the all-time series.
The Orange are coming off a 95-66 victory over Oakland, while Georgetown is coming off a 75-68 win over Siena.
The game will be nationally televised on ABC, with tipoff set for 1 p.m.
